The 42,000-square foot-location is the … WebReaction time is the last dash point for skill-related components of physical fitness. It refers to the speed at which an athlete responds to an external stimulus. Reaction time relates directly to agility but is a smaller component of physical fitness. Reaction time relates to performance because it is used frequently in various sporting scenarios. […]

Regardless of its classification, reaction time is … green waste of tehama countyWebSep 11, 2024 · Reaction time is a skill that often goes overlooked in sports and athletic performance. It refers to the time it takes for your central and peripheral nervous systems to receive a stimulus, process it, and create the correct response for it.
